Newsom affirms school mask mandate following OC education board legal threat

Gov. Gavin Newsom said Friday he remains firmly behind the state mandate for students and teachers to wear masks as in-person instruction resumes across the state, despite multiple legal challenges, including one planned by the Orange County Board of Education. … Dr. Dan Cooper of UC Irvine’s Institute for Immunology, who has been active in the university’s COVID-19 pandemic research, called the assertion “a falsehood.” … Andrew Noymer, an epidemiologist and UC Irvine [associate] professor of population health and disease prevention, also disputed the Board of Education’s claims.
